Busy Bees indoor play and party space in Chevy Chase

July 7, 2017

Busy Bees:
An indoor playground and party space, designed for kids under 48″ only. They make no exceptions to this rule in order to create a space where little ones won’t be pushed around by the tall/older kids and will feel comfortable to jump around and play.

Pay each visit:
One Child All Day Play Pass: $18
Siblings All Day Play Pass: $15
Parents and kids under 1: Always free!
Silly hour (the last hour of the day): $12
Weekend of interrupted play(when we have private parties): $15
Military Rate: $15

Or purchase a BusyPass:
Admission is always discounted: 5 admissions for $75. That’s $15 per visit.

Hours:
Weekday open play hours: 9:00 am – 5:00 pm…..FINALLY a place that opens before 10:00am!!!!!!!
Weekend open play hours*: 11:00 am – 5:00 pm (*May change depending on partied etc. See Facebook page for updates)

​Seven reasons to LOVE Busy Bees:

  1. Everything at BusyBees moves, spins, or flies! Flying balloons, spinning climbing apparatuses, light up slides and more.

  2. Nut free! Snacks for sale.
  3. They offer fun and adorably themed parties.

  4. In-N-Out-N-In… your admission covers you all day during open play.

  5. Sparkling Clean C-O-N-S-T-A-N-T-L-Y! Thanks to Dapple natural cleaning products.

  6. Complimentary coffee/tea for the sleep deprived.

  7. Free wifi with chairs for adults outside of the play area. A gate separates the play area from the seating area, my kids thought they were “locked” in– it was glorious!

Rules: 
Everyone requires socks at all times: no shoes / bare-feet.
Everyone requires a signed waiver before playing– once you sign it, your waiver is good forever.
Have fun! Play hard! Nap even harder afterwards!

Location:  
11 Wisconsin Circle Chevy Chase, MD. 20815
Conveniently located next to Friendship Heights Metro, Potomac Pizza, Sweet Teensy Bakery & Giant.
